Sean Mannion emphasizes Jalen Hurts' rushing ability for Eagles offense
Summary

Sean Mannion, the first-year offensive coordinator for the Philadelphia Eagles, plans to incorporate Jalen Hurts' unique rushing ability into the team's offensive strategy. Mannion highlighted Hurts' dual-threat capability as a key asset against defenses, stating that the designed runs will also create opportunities for other players, like Saquon Barkley. While acknowledging Hurts' mobility, Mannion aims to ensure the quarterback uses his full skill set while minimizing the risk of injury throughout the season. Training camp practices have shown Hurts operating comfortably within all aspects of the offense, suggesting a balanced approach will define their game plan moving forward.
